titleOfInvention | Microcatheter system and method of packaging the same |
abstract | The invention discloses a micro-catheter system and a method for packaging and using the same. The micro-catheter system comprises a guide wire, a catheter, a irrigator, a wire needle, a shaping needle, and a twisting device; the guide wire can penetrate the catheter In the lumen, the auxiliary catheter enters the target position in the blood vessel, and then the guide wire is withdrawn from the body. The catheter is used as a channel for delivering embolic materials, drugs or contrast agents and remains in the lumen of the blood vessel. Materials, drugs or contrast agents are injected into the target blood vessel through the catheter; the irrigator is used for irrigating the catheter, guide wire, etc.; the shaping needle consists of a straight core wire, which is used for shaping the tip of the catheter; The auxiliary guide wire enters the catheter or the auxiliary guide wire is shaped; the twist control device is used for the twist control of the guide wire. The microcatheter system of the present invention has low cost, high convenience and operability, can meet the needs of daily treatment, such as the classic TACE operation, and is of great significance in the fields of medical devices and the like. |
